Output e4f65c356addf950ccfb9332393749a79e939353d8c714dea680dd4168c37fde:105

value
228608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c924084d0c80b170651a64a5c2a10b0cc0a27f1 OP_EQUALVERIFY OP_CHECKSIG
address
129UK57abXZsgZLukNvchScqq38K8Rs4o7
transaction
e4f65c356addf950ccfb9332393749a79e939353d8c714dea680dd4168c37fde
spent
true